>>>> Putting device into the "Suspend-To-Idle" mode causes watchdog to
>>>> trigger and reset the board after set watchdog timeout period elapses.
>>>>
>>>> Introduce new device-tree property "fsl,suspend-in-wait" which suspends
>>>> watchdog in WAIT mode. This is done by setting WDW bit in WCR
>>>> (Watchdog Control Register) Watchdog operation is restored after exiting
>>>> WAIT mode as expected. WAIT mode coresponds with Linux's
>>>> "Suspend-To-Idle".

>>> So the models listed in
>>> Documentation/devicetree/bindings/watchdog/fsl-imx-
>>> wdt.yaml not supporting this feature are
>>> * fsl,imx21-wdt
>>> * fsl,imx27-wdt
>>> * fsl,imx31-wdt
>>> * fsl,ls1012a-wdt
>>> * fsl,ls1043a-wdt
>>> ?
>>
>> yes, you are correct.
>>
>>> But all models are listed as compatible to fsl,imx21-wdt. So there is
>>> something wrong here. IMHO this sounds like the compatible list has to be
>>> split and updated. Depending on that this feature can be detected.
>>> Maintaining another list seems error prone to me.
>>
>> So basically the compatible lists would be split into two groups, one
>> for the devices which support this WDW bit and the rest which don't
>> support this?
> 
> This was my idea, so only one set has to be maintained.
> 
>> You got a point here, but...this means that every processors
>> device-tree, which has two compatible strings (with "fsl,imx21-wdt")
>> should be updated, right? That sounds like quite a lot of changes, which
>> I'd like to avoid if possible.
> 
> Well, the compatible list right now doesn't reflect the hardware features/
> compatibility correctly, so IMHO it should be fixed.
> But apparently Krzysztof is okay having the special property only applicable
> for a specific set of devices. But in this case you will have to maintain two
> sets of device models (bindings + driver) to which WDW applies/does not apply
> to.
